Your duties and responsibilities will include:

  • Provide comprehensive legal support to tender teams across Oman, UAE, and Qatar, including meticulous review and strategic guidance on tender documents, contracts, pre-tender agreements, and joint venture agreements
  • Offer astute legal counsel throughout the lifecycle of ongoing construction projects, encompassing build-only, design & build, turnkey projects, and potential PPP initiatives, ensuring meticulous legal analysis during project execution and adept support in public procurement procedures
  • Oversee corporate housekeeping for Middle East Group companies, demonstrating proficiency in preparing PoAs, drafting board resolutions, and maintaining vigilance over legal developments, while effectively disseminating pertinent information internally
  • Assume a leadership role in facilitating dispute resolution processes, specializing in international arbitration, and guiding the resolution of disputes through various channels, whether international institutions or local entities, with an unwavering commitment to legal excellence
  • Engage in negotiations with clients, consortium partners, advisors, and subcontractors, leveraging expertise to achieve favorable outcomes and mitigate legal risks, while orchestrating the tendering, selection, and coordination of external legal advisors
  • Demonstrate a keen eye for detail in drafting and reviewing a spectrum of agreements crucial to construction projects, including project agreements, construction contracts, design agreements, supply contracts, financing agreements, and advisory contracts
  • Exemplify dedication to internal housekeeping matters, offering invaluable legal support and guidance as needed, and ensuring adherence to regulatory compliance standards and best practices
  • Closely collaborate with the Legal Department to achieve effectiveness and optimal business results
